1.0.7 • Published 1 year ago

countdown-circle-vue v1.0.7

Weekly downloads
-
License
ISC
Repository
-
Last release
1 year ago

安装

npm/yarn/pnpm 安装

npm i @dreamjser/countdown-circle-vue
yarn add @dreamjser/countdown-circle-vue
pnpm add @dreamjser/countdown-circle-vue

引入组件

// 引入样式文件
import '@dreamjser/countdown-circlev-vue/es/style.css'
import CountdownCircle from '@dreamjser/countdown-circlev-vue'

组件实例

<script setup lang="ts">
import '@dreamjser/countdown-circlev-vue/es/style.css'
import { ref, onMounted } from 'vue'
import CountdownCircle from '@dreamjser/countdown-circle-vue'

const countdown = ref<InstanceType<typeof CountdownCircle> | null>(null)

onMounted(() => {
  countdown.value?.run()
})
</script>

<template>
  <CountdownCircle ref="countdown" :time-out="20" circle-color="red"></CountdownCircle>
</template>

组件属性

参数说明类型默认值
timeOut倒计时时间number10
circleColor倒计时圆环颜色string#000

组件方法

方法名说明回调参数
run开始倒计时-